Law Firm Seeks Experienced Personal Injury Defense Paralegal Wilson Elser's New York Midtown office is currently seeking an experienced and certified Personal Injury Defense Paralegal to join their team. This position entails being part of a team-oriented approach, working with attorneys and paralegals to coordinate the evaluation and resolution of each matter. The Firm Wilson Elser is a full-service and leading defense litigation law firm with over 1,000 attorneys across 42 offices in the United States and one in London. Founded in 1978, they are ranked among the top 200 law firms in the country by The American Lawyer and 53rd in The National Law Journal's survey of the nation's largest law firms. Qualifications Must have a Bachelor’s degree, and Paralegal certification is preferred Must have 2+ years of New York State Litigation experience, with Personal Injury claims Strong computer skills with proficiency in MS Office Suite, especially Word and Excel, as well as, document management systems Clear and effective communication skills both orally and in writing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ail Must be able to work both independently and in a team mindset and be proactive Must be able to multitask and successfully manage a variety of demands daily Medical Record interpretation and summaries experience preferred Legal Research (Lexis, Westlaw) proficiency preferred Responsibilities Professional written work product, with ability to concisely explain what matters most and why – for audiences that will include clients, courts, and litigant counsel Interaction with investigators: including evaluation of claim needs in line with goals, and communication and supervision of investigation process Interact with client contacts for information, document, and witness information gathering, evaluation, and assessment as bears on investigation and discovery process and resolution strategies Medical record interpretation, evaluation, and summarization of contents as matters to critical liability, damages, and discovery issues Written discovery demand and response preparation and compliance supervision – both internal and external Review, analyze and organize document productions by opposing parties and co-defendants Determine, prepare and organize materials needed for court appearances, pleadings, depositions, and trial preparation Determine, prepare and organize material needed for expert witness review Witness interaction for critical information gathering, and deposition process Discovery and substantive motion support, such as drafting and preparing, as commensurate with skill set The annualized salary range for this position is $50,000 to $70,000.
